Output ec7f3faf3693990b004329f7a8a7104784b8b25f609e4e8e310e0965a18b0631:3

value
295000
script pubkey
OP_0 OP_PUSHBYTES_20 63520cfd4fe4a114477c88774e8bfe13fc8f2c72
address
bc1qvdfqel20ujs3g3mu3pm5azl7z07g7trjgytpq5
transaction
ec7f3faf3693990b004329f7a8a7104784b8b25f609e4e8e310e0965a18b0631
confirmations
84036
spent
true